Home
last modified time | relevance | path

Searched refs:usb (Results 1 – 25 of 60) sorted by relevance

123

/qemu/docs/system/devices/
H A Dusb.rst103 ``usb-mouse``
107 ``usb-tablet``
127 ``usb-uas``
147 ``usb-bot``
154 ``usb-uas`` example above won't work with ``usb-bot``.
171 ``usb-kbd``
203 ``usb-ccid``
206 ``usb-audio``
229 -device usb-tablet,bus=usb-bus.0,port=1
233 -device usb-hub,bus=usb-bus.0,port=2
[all …]
H A Dccid.rst20 cannot be used on a guest with simple usb passthrough since it will then not be
49 qemu -usb -device usb-ccid -device ccid-card-emulated
68 …qemu -usb -device usb-ccid -device ccid-card-emulated,backend=certificates,db=sql:$PWD,cert1=id-ce…
104 -usb -device usb-ccid -device ccid-card-passthru,chardev=ccid
121 -usb -device usb-ccid -device ccid-card-passthru,chardev=ccid
128 usb-ccid is a usb device. It defaults to an unattached usb device on startup.
129 usb-ccid expects a chardev and expects the protocol defined in
131 The usb-ccid device can be in one of three modes:
140 client event | vscclient | passthru | usb-ccid | guest event
144 … | | | | sees new usb device.
[all …]
H A Dusb-u2f.rst31 |qemu_system| -usb -device u2f-passthru,hidraw=/dev/hidraw0
38 |qemu_system| -usb -device u2f-passthru
71 |qemu_system| -usb -device u2f-emulated
82 |qemu_system| -usb -device u2f-emulated,dir=$dir
93 …|qemu_system| -usb -device u2f-emulated,cert=$DIR1/$FILE1,priv=$DIR2/$FILE2,counter=$DIR3/$FILE3,e…
H A Dcanokey.rst86 |qemu_system| -usb -device canokey,file=$HOME/.canokey-file
126 -usb -device canokey,file=$HOME/.canokey-file
132 |qemu_system| -usb -device canokey,file=$HOME/.canokey-file,pcap=key.pcap
143 |qemu_system| -usb -device canokey,file=$HOME/.canokey-file \\
/qemu/docs/config/
H A Dich9-ehci-uhci.cfg9 # Specify "bus=ehci.0" when creating usb devices to hook them up
14 driver = "ich9-usb-ehci1"
19 driver = "ich9-usb-uhci1"
26 driver = "ich9-usb-uhci2"
33 driver = "ich9-usb-uhci3"
H A Dq35-emulated.cfg170 driver = "ich9-usb-ehci1"
176 driver = "ich9-usb-uhci1"
184 driver = "ich9-usb-uhci2"
192 driver = "ich9-usb-uhci3"
206 driver = "ich9-usb-ehci2"
212 driver = "ich9-usb-uhci4"
220 driver = "ich9-usb-uhci5"
228 driver = "ich9-usb-uhci6"
H A Dmach-virt-graphical.cfg249 [device "usb"]
250 driver = "nec-usb-xhci"
255 driver = "usb-kbd"
256 bus = "usb.0"
259 driver = "usb-tablet"
260 bus = "usb.0"
H A Dq35-virtio-graphical.cfg201 [device "usb"]
202 driver = "nec-usb-xhci"
207 driver = "usb-tablet"
208 bus = "usb.0"
/qemu/docs/
H A Dmultiseat.txt21 qemu -accel kvm -usb $memory $disk $whatever \
24 -device usb-tablet
27 standard ps/2 keyboard (implicitly there) and the usb-tablet. Now the
32 -device nec-usb-xhci,bus=head.2,addr=0f.0,id=usb.2 \
33 -device usb-kbd,bus=usb.2.0,port=1,display=video.2 \
34 -device usb-tablet,bus=usb.2.0,port=2,display=video.2
37 xhci (usb) controller to the bridge. Then it adds a usb keyboard and
38 usb mouse, both connected to the xhci and linked to the display.
52 ... instead of xhci and usb hid devices.
91 should list the pci bridge with the display adapter and usb controller:
H A Dqdev-device-use.txt137 -device usb-storage,drive=DRIVE-ID,removable=RMB
143 Bug: usb-storage pretends to be a block device, but it's really a SCSI
186 -device usb-braille,chardev=braille -chardev braille,id=braille
189 -device usb-serial,chardev=dev.
256 you have to use usb-net.
339 * ccid -device usb-ccid
340 * keyboard -device usb-kbd
341 * mouse -device usb-mouse
342 * tablet -device usb-tablet
343 * wacom-tablet -device usb-wacom-tablet
[all …]
/qemu/hw/usb/
H A Dmeson.build3 # usb subsystem core
14 # usb host adapters
32 system_ss.add(when: 'CONFIG_IMX_USBPHY', if_true: files('imx-usb-phy.c'))
35 system_ss.add(when: 'CONFIG_XLNX_USB_SUBSYS', if_true: files('xlnx-usb-subsystem.c'))
37 # emulated usb devices
76 # usb redirect
84 # usb pass-through
92 system_ss.add(when: ['CONFIG_USB', 'CONFIG_XEN_BUS', libusb], if_true: files('xen-usb.c'))
94 modules += { 'hw-usb': hw_usb_modules }
/qemu/hw/arm/
H A Dxlnx-zynqmp.c443 object_initialize_child(obj, "usb[*]", &s->usb[i], TYPE_USB_DWC3); in xlnx_zynqmp_init()
827 if (!object_property_set_link(OBJECT(&s->usb[i].sysbus_xhci), "dma", in xlnx_zynqmp_realize()
832 qdev_prop_set_uint32(DEVICE(&s->usb[i].sysbus_xhci), "intrs", 4); in xlnx_zynqmp_realize()
833 qdev_prop_set_uint32(DEVICE(&s->usb[i].sysbus_xhci), "slots", 2); in xlnx_zynqmp_realize()
835 if (!sysbus_realize(SYS_BUS_DEVICE(&s->usb[i]), errp)) { in xlnx_zynqmp_realize()
839 sysbus_mmio_map(SYS_BUS_DEVICE(&s->usb[i]), 0, usb_addr[i]); in xlnx_zynqmp_realize()
840 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i].sysbus_xhci), 0, in xlnx_zynqmp_realize()
842 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i].sysbus_xhci), 1, in xlnx_zynqmp_realize()
844 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i].sysbus_xhci), 2, in xlnx_zynqmp_realize()
846 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i].sysbus_xhci), 3, in xlnx_zynqmp_realize()
H A Dfsl-imx25.c75 object_initialize_child(obj, "usb[*]", &s->usb[i], TYPE_CHIPIDEA); in fsl_imx25_init()
267 sysbus_realize(SYS_BUS_DEVICE(&s->usb[i]), &error_abort); in fsl_imx25_realize()
268 sysbus_mmio_map(SYS_BUS_DEVICE(&s->usb[i]), 0, usb_table[i].addr); in fsl_imx25_realize()
269 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x25_realize()
H A Dfsl-imx6.c93 object_initialize_child(obj, name, &s->usb[i], TYPE_CHIPIDEA); in fsl_imx6_init()
357 sysbus_realize(SYS_BUS_DEVICE(&s->usb[i]), &error_abort); in fsl_imx6_realize()
358 sysbus_mmio_map(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x6_realize()
360 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x6_realize()
H A Dfsl-imx7.c159 object_initialize_child(obj, name, &s->usb[i], TYPE_CHIPIDEA); in fsl_imx7_init()
631 sysbus_realize(SYS_BUS_DEVICE(&s->usb[i]), &error_abort); in fsl_imx7_realize()
632 sysbus_mmio_map(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x7_realize()
636 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i]), 0, irq); in fsl_imx7_realize()
H A Dfsl-imx6ul.c136 object_initialize_child(obj, name, &s->usb[i], TYPE_CHIPIDEA); in fsl_imx6ul_init()
520 sysbus_realize(SYS_BUS_DEVICE(&s->usb[i]), &error_abort); in fsl_imx6ul_realize()
521 sysbus_mmio_map(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x6ul_realize()
523 sysbus_connect_irq(SYS_BUS_DEVICE(&s->usb[i]), 0, in fsl_imx6ul_realize()
/qemu/tests/qtest/libqos/
H A Dmeson.build25 # usb
26 'usb.c',
/qemu/scripts/coverity-scan/
H A DCOMPONENTS.md120 usb
121 ~ (/qemu)?(/hw/usb/.*|/include/hw/usb/.*)
/qemu/tests/qtest/
H A Dmeson.build66 (config_all_devices.has_key('CONFIG_USB_UHCI') ? ['usb-hcd-uhci-test'] : []) + \
68 config_all_devices.has_key('CONFIG_USB_EHCI') ? ['usb-hcd-ehci-test'] : []) + \
69 (config_all_devices.has_key('CONFIG_USB_XHCI_NEC') ? ['usb-hcd-xhci-test'] : []) + \
177 (config_all_devices.has_key('CONFIG_USB_UHCI') ? ['usb-hcd-uhci-test'] : []) + \
178 (config_all_devices.has_key('CONFIG_USB_XHCI_NEC') ? ['usb-hcd-xhci-test'] : []) + \
286 'usb-hcd-ohci-test.c',
/qemu/scripts/ci/org.centos/stream/8/x86_64/
H A Dconfigure125 --disable-usb-redir \
188 --enable-usb-redir \
/qemu/include/hw/arm/
H A Dxlnx-zynqmp.h136 USBDWC3 usb[XLNX_ZYNQMP_NUM_USB]; member
H A Dfsl-imx25.h63 ChipideaState usb[FSL_IMX25_NUM_USBS]; member
/qemu/hw/
H A Dmeson.build40 subdir('usb') subdir
/qemu/tests/avocado/acpi-bits/bits-tests/
H A Dsmilatency.py237 import usb
87 if usb.handoff_to_os():
/qemu/docs/system/
H A Ddevice-emulation.rst92 devices/usb.rst
100 devices/usb-u2f.rst

123